| CHROMONE Usage And Synthesis |
| Chemical Properties | White to slightly yellow crystalline powder | | Definition | ChEBI: The simplest member of the class of chromones that is 4H-chromene with an oxo group at position 4. | | Synthesis Reference(s) | Journal of Heterocyclic Chemistry, 16, p. 369, 1979 DOI: 10.1002/jhet.5570160234The Journal of Organic Chemistry, 48, p. 5160, 1983 DOI: 10.1021/jo00174a003Synthetic Communications, 16, p. 365, 1986 DOI: 10.1080/00397918608076319 | | General Description | The compounds with chromone skeleton exhibits antiradical activities that provide protection against oxidative stress. |
